What is Kansas Certificate Replacement

The Kansas Certificate Replacement Form is a government document used by individuals in Kansas to request a replacement or name change for their nurse aide, home health aide, or medication aide certificates.

Comprehensive Guide to Kansas Certificate Replacement

What is the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form?

The Kansas Certificate Replacement Form is designed for individuals seeking to replace or change the name on their Kansas nurse aide, home health aide, or medication aide certificates. This form ensures that professionals maintain valid credentials, which are crucial for their roles in the healthcare sector. The processing time for applications can take up to ten business days, ensuring timely updates to professional qualifications.

Eligibility Criteria for the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form

Eligible applicants for the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form include nurse aides, home health aides, and medication aides. Applicants must provide specific forms of identification along with documentation supporting any name changes. Additionally, there may be age or residency requirements that need to be met for successful application submission.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ials

The application necessitates the submission of various documents, which include:
  • Government-issued identification
  • Old certificate of the professional
  • Documentation required for a name change, if applicable
Ensure that all documents clearly display necessary information and are submitted alongside the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form to avoid processing delays.

Fees, Deadlines, and Processing Time for the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form

The application fee for the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form is $20, with several payment methods available for convenience. After submission, the expected processing time can take up to ten business days, so plan accordingly. Any individual in Kansas who holds a nurse aide, home health aide, or medication aide certificate can use this form to request a replacement or name change.
The processing of the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form may take up to 10 business days. It's advisable to apply well in advance of any deadlines.
You must provide a valid form of identification, documentation for any name changes, the certificate being replaced, and a $20 processing fee to complete the application.
You can submit the completed form electronically through pdfFiller, or print it and send it to the designated state office as instructions dictate on the form.
Ensure all fields are filled out correctly, particularly the identification and fee sections. Double-check spellings and that you have included all necessary supporting documents.
No, the Kansas Certificate Replacement Form does not require notarization. Simply complete the form, sign it, and submit it following the instructions provided.
